REVEALING the dreaded news he had cancer, the nation expected King Charles would hand the reins to the younger royals.
But he has resolutely refused to allow the disease, or an exhausting diary of engagements, to beat him.
At 77, he has been crowned the hardest-working royal of 2025, clocking up an impressive 532 engagements — 50 more than his sister Princess Anne, famed for her work ethic.
It means out of the 2,458 official royal engagements this year, the King carried out almost a quarter (22%).
His engagements have taken him up and down the country as well as trips to Italy to meet Pope Leo XIV, Canada and Poland, for the 80th anniversary of the liberation of Auschwitz.
The King stepped up his workload at the start of the year following positive progress with his cancer care. And despite a “minor bump” requiring a short stay in hospital to treat side-effects in March, he has ploughed on.
Just last week, he shared the good news that in the New Year his cancer treatment will be scaled back.
Analysis of the Court Circular, the official record of royal engagements, shows 75-year-old Anne, despite working more days than her brother — 186 - carried out 478 duties. Next came the Duke of Edinburgh, Prince Edward, 61, on 313 followed by his wife Sophie, the Duchess of Edinburgh, 60, in fourth on 235. Queen Camilla, 78, was fifth on 228.
